Title: Saving It
Author: Monica Murphy
Publication Date: November 6, 2017Publisher: Entangled Teen Crush
Eden: Josh Evans and I have been best friends forever. He knows all my secrets, and I know all of his. So when he randomly asks me to help him lose his virginity, I sort of flip out. That’s a question that sends your mind to places you’ve seriously never considered before. Like, you know. Having sex. With your best friend. Except Josh doesn’t want to have sex with me—he wants me to help him find a girl. A nice girl who’s funny and smart and cute. Except he already knows a girl just like that…
Josh: Eden Sumner is my best friend. So of course she’d be the person to help me find my perfect match, so I can drop my V card before I head off to college. Except the more we search, the more I realize that maybe the right girl has been by my side all along. I don’t need Eden’s help in finding me a girl to love. I’m pretty sure I’m already in love with Eden. But now she thinks I’m only after one thing…with anyone but her.
Disclaimer: This Entangled Teen Crush book is what happens when American Pie meets Friends with Benefits. It contains two best friends, plenty of angst, and lots and lots of sex talk. Reading this might have you looking at your best friend in a different light!

Saving It is my kind of cute teen romance. I think the one thing I loved most above all was how they tried to deny and pretend nothing was happening -when everything was happening <3. The evolution of their friendship was amazing. They learnt to be a little more "open" with each other. Although without confessing what was really in their minds.
So, Josh's reasons for losing his V-card lead him to ask for help. And who is better than his BFF? Nobody. Most of the time he was cute when trying to talk about it. And of course, as his BFF, Eden did not make it any easier for him. Eden --with every minute that passed, she realized it was inevitable.
Its plot is the result of a young friends-to-something-more friendship. Eden and Josh. And as I was saying, I though it was cute how both characters developed feelings in a way they knew would lead to a change in their relationship. The idea of considering to be the one for each other? It make it harder for them to be objective when it comes to their friendship. But at the end of the day, how they solve it was the best they could do. Love it!

Title: Offsetting Penalties
Author: Ally Mathews
Publication Date: November 6, 2017Publisher: Entangled Teen Crush
Isabelle Oster has dreamed of being a prima ballerina her entire life, so when the only male dancer backs out of the fall production, she’s devastated. Without a partner, she has no hope of earning a spot with the prestigious Ballet Americana company. Until hot jock Garret practicing stretches in one of the studios gives Izzy an idea, and she whips out her phone. But does she really want this badly enough to resort to blackmail?
All-state tight end Garret Mitchell will do anything to get a college football scholarship. Even taking ballet, which surprisingly isn’t so bad, because it means he gets to be up close and personal with the gorgeous Goth girl Izzy while learning moves to increase his flexibility. But Izzy needs him to perform with her for the Ballet Americana spot, and he draws the line at getting on stage. Especially wearing tights.
Disclaimer: This Entangled Teen Crush book contains a bit of blackmail, a lot of sarcasm, and an ending guaranteed to melt your heart.

I think I have a not-so-secret love for cute young adult romance books. They are lovely, and sometimes, they are also what you need to relax while reading. Plus, I did enjoy reading Offsetting Penalties.
This book has two amazing characters who --I can assure you-- have crystal-clear what they want to do with their lives. And they both want to do what they love most --football and ballet. Hence, no matter what, they are ready to do whatever it takes in order to make them come true. Furthermore, Izzy has a soft spot even if she does not want people to know it. So, when it comes to blackmailing others? I will just say that she is better at dancing. Garret... oh boy! He got the moves. I could definitely picture him dancing ballet.
Overall, this book is a clear demonstration that you do not have to judge someone for their exterior. And despite the fact that there was a moment/scene -almost at the end- when I felt it was too forced. It was an amazing reading and plot.
